Queen of Peace moved up to 231 from 267 in the state rankings this week, the biggest jump in North Jersey - Meadowlands. The Golden Griffins climbed the ranks as a result of a 12-7 win over the Warriors.
Angelo Nocciolo put up the best numbers through the air as North Arlington lost to Saddle Brook. He finished with a total of nine completions for 79 yards and one touchdown. Nocciolo's favorite target this week was Nicholas Martin, who caught three passes for 38 yards.
Roy Forys was the best wideout in the league this week as Becton fell to Palisades Park/Leonia. Forys racked up three receptions for 70 yards. Jesse Foote helped Becton's passing attack out by catching five balls for 56 yards.
Eric Johnson was the most productive running back in the league this week. He ran for 81 yards on 13 carries as the Tigers lost to the Tigers. Teammate Robert Then added to the ground attack by rushing for 70 yards.
The Vikings' Nocciolo and Mike Brazzel have formed a dynamic duo this season, leading North Jersey - Meadowlands in both passing and receiving yards. Nocciolo has thrown for 1076 yards this season, while Brazzel, a 5-foot-7 receiver, has 17 catches for 389 yards. Hasbrouck Heights's Anthony Seidel leads the league in rushing yards with 605.
Two of the top units in the league will face off this week when the Aviators take on the Falcons. Hasbrouck Heights' offense has scored 184 points this season, good for No. 1 in the league, while Saddle Brook has allowed only 48 on the year.
The top two defenses in the league will face off this season when the Aviators take on the Falcons. Hasbrouck Heights has allowed 60 points this season, while Saddle Brook has given up 48. The Aviators allowed 6 points last week as they defeated Emerson.
The Falcons extended the longest winning streak in the league this week by beating North Arlington, 40-14. The victory was the fifth in a row for the team.
